The person in the chair on the right is "Driver" and his wife "Pit Stop" is taking the picture. They are CDT hikers and I've crossed paths with this couple a few times on trail. They are from Mississippi and have already hiked the AT and PCT. They seem to be loving the trail.
Today's hike included a serious climb on a warm afternoon and the trail magic by Crazy Joe was a surprise and much appreciated. He had water, soda, beer, and an assortment of foods. He was cooking dinner when I arrived: potatoes, sweet corn, cheese and BACON all mixed together like a stew. He offered me a chair and served me a big bowl! It was nice to sit, eat, hydrate and relax before continuing down the trail for a few more miles. Thanks Crazy Joe for your hospitality!
